About

Lovska Koča LD Planota sits at 1,532m on Planota plateau in the Julian Alps, a working hunting lodge that welcomes hikers. Reach it from the Kranjska Gora side via the Perica valley in roughly 3 hours, or approach from Jezersko in the Kamnik-Savinja Alps. The hut lies on the PZS network and marks a junction point for routes toward Ratitovec and Stenar. This location works well as a base for day walks across open moorland or as a stage on longer ridge traverses.
The lodge operates as a mountain hut during hiking season with 20 beds across mixed dormitories and a small number of private rooms. The kitchen serves meals on request; bring a packed lunch for day trips or order ahead. No WiFi. The hut opens year-round but runs at reduced capacity and may require advance notice outside peak season (May to October). Toilets are basic and water comes from a reliable spring.
Contact the hut directly through the PZS directory or call ahead to confirm availability and book meals. July and August fill quickly; aim to reserve at least one week in advance during summer. Sp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October) offer quieter conditions with good weather windows for longer walks. The hut is family-friendly and caters to local hunting groups, so booking is essential on weekends year-round.
